The Top 10 Watches Spotted at The Masters 2025 — Ranked by Price

The Masters is as much about timeless tradition as it is about cutting-edge performance, both on the course and on the wrist. Each year, golf’s most prestigious tournament draws in not just the world’s best players, but also some serious wristwear.

The Top 10 Watches Spotted at The Masters 2025 —From subtle elegance to full-blown haute horlogerie, here’s a rundown of the top 10 watches spotted at The Masters 2025, ranked by retail price:

Phil Mickelson – Rolex Cellini Ref. 4233 masters 202510. Phil Mickelson – Rolex Cellini Ref. 4233 (4,000 EUR)
Kicking things off with a classic, Phil Mickelson sported a white gold Rolex Cellini — a model that doesn’t scream for attention, but speaks volumes in elegance.

Understated and refined, much like Phil himself, this is the perfect nod to traditional watchmaking.

9. Roger Federer – Rolex Land-Dweller (14,000 EUR)
Spotted once again among the crowd at Augusta, Roger Federer brought his A-game in watch form.
The new Rolex Land-Dweller — a robust, sporty timepiece with adventure in its DNA — was his wrist companion.

A fresh release from Rolex, it’s already creating buzz among collectors.

8. Rory McIlroy – Omega Speedmaster Snoopy Edition (14,000 EUR)
The man of the hour. Rory finally slipped on that elusive green jacket and completed his career Grand Slam.

And while the trophy sparkled, so did his Omega Speedmaster "Snoopy" — a fan-favorite nod to NASA history, known for its playful design and collectible status.

7. Justin Rose – Rolex Day-Date with Meteorite & Diamond Dial (60,000 EUR)
Justin Rose, ever the gentleman, wore a stellar (literally) piece: a Rolex Day-Date with a meteorite dial and diamond hour markers.

Luxurious, rare, and with a cosmic flair, this watch stood out quietly amidst the Augusta greens.

6. Min Woo Lee – De Bethune DB28XS Starry Seas (80,000 EUR)
Australia’s own Min Woo Lee took to the course wearing an indie grail — the De Bethune DB28XS Starry Seas.

With its hypnotic dial reminiscent of a star-filled night sky and futuristic lugs, this was easily one of the most artistic watches of the tournament.

5. Fred Ridley – Platinum Rolex Daytona (100,000 EUR)
The chairman of Augusta National, Fred Ridley, kept it classy with a platinum Rolex Daytona — icy cool and effortlessly authoritative.

The Daytona’s status is legendary, and this particular version might just outshine the trophy.

4. The McIlroy Couple: Patek & Omega Combo (110,000 EUR + 120,000 EUR)
Here’s where it gets spicy. Rory’s wife Erika was seen wearing a rose gold and diamond-set Patek Philippe Nautilus (110,000 EUR), allegedly chosen to send a not-so-subtle message perhaps directed at CBS sports journalist Amanda Balionis, whose name has been whispered alongside Rory’s a bit too often lately. 
Rory was also seen with the Omega DeVille Tourbillon — a technical marvel retailing at 120,000 EUR.

3. Jon Rahm – Rolex Daytona Le Mans (250,000 EUR)
A beast on the course, and clearly off it too — Jon Rahm brought fire to the wrist with the yellow gold Rolex Daytona Le Mans edition.

A bold tribute to endurance racing, and a highly coveted collector’s piece, this was the watch that turned heads and sparked envy.

2. Caroline Wozniacki – Off-Catalog Rolex Daytona (380,000 EUR)
Caroline Wozniacki, the tennis legend turned watch queen, might’ve had the rarest piece of the day: an off-catalog Rolex Daytona — rarely seen, even less so outside Rolex’s inner circle.

With a six-figure price tag and ultra-exclusive status, this was a flex few could match.

  1. Bubba Watson – Richard Mille RM038 Tourbillon (Approx. 2.2 Million EUR)
    And finally, at number one — no contest — is Bubba Watson. Known for his pink driver and bold personality, he wore none other than a Richard Mille RM038 Tourbillon, a watch developed in collaboration with him.

    Ultra-light, tourbillon-equipped, and retailing around a jaw-dropping $2.5 million, this is a piece reserved for the elite of the elite.
    On or off the green, Bubba doesn’t play it safe.
